首页 > 试题广场 >

要发送的数据为1101011011。采用CRC的生成多项式是

[单选题]
要发送的数据为1101011011。采用CRC的生成多项式是P(X)=X^4+X+1。那么应该添加在数据后边的余数是多少?( )
  • 1011
  • 1010
  • 0010
  • 1110
1、发送数据 比特 序列为1101011011(10比特);
2、生成 多项式 比特序列为10011(5比特,K=4); X的指数就是代表第几位为1,而且1=X的 0次方
3、将发送数据比特序列乘以2的K(由2可知K为4),那么产生的乘积为11010110110000;
 4、将乘积用生成多项式比特序列去除,按模二算法得到余数1110; 模二算法就是两数相减不产生借位,0-1=1;
编辑于 2017-03-06 14:55:23 回复(0)
要发送数据110101101   CRC最大指数为4    发送数据左移4位 得到1101011011 0000
根据多项式得到除数为 10011

1101011011 0000除以10011  得到余数
发表于 2017-02-24 11:09:32 回复(2)
我也算到是1110,我忘记左移四位的时候是算到A答案的1011,反正算不到0001
发表于 2017-03-28 11:59:02 回复(0)
忘记左移四位了。
发表于 2017-03-17 10:25:58 回复(0)
为啥不是1110呢
发表于 2017-03-14 14:42:25 回复(0)
我算了好几遍都是1110
发表于 2017-03-03 20:37:32 回复(4)
我算出来是1110
发表于 2017-03-02 12:38:53 回复(1)
余数算几次都是1110,有人一样吗
发表于 2017-02-24 13:52:03 回复(5)
求解答
发表于 2017-02-22 20:03:31 回复(0)
这**。算是这样算,答案是1110啊。。纯粹蒙对。具体见下面:
            1100001010 = 求得的商 (我们不需要)
       _______________
10011 ) 11010110110000 = (扩展生成多项式的最高位) (1101011011 + 0000)
        10011,,.,,....
        -----,,.,,....
         10011,.,,....
         10011,.,,....
         -----,.,,....
          00001.,,....
          00000.,,....
          -----.,,....
           00010,,....
           00000,,....
           -----,,....
            00101,....
            00000,....
            -----,....
             01011....
             00000....
             -----....
              10110...
              10011...
              -----...
               01010..
               00000..
               -----..
                10100.
                10011.
                -----.
                 01110
                 00000
                 -----
                  1110 = 余数 = 校验项!!!!
里面题目好多问题Orz,JD出题太不认真了吧。
编辑于 2017-03-18 19:28:54 回复(2)
Ev头像 Ev
发表于 2018-01-25 17:17:21 回复(0)
谁能给详细解答下这题,完全看不懂啊
发表于 2017-09-08 15:06:30 回复(0)
为什么我做到这一题是怎么都提交不了,无法进入下一题,无法交卷。
发表于 2017-04-06 14:35:55 回复(0)